Raja Ram Mohan Roy was a social reformer who campaigned for the abolition of The SATI system. Because of his efforts, Governor-General of India William Bentinck passed a law in 1829 making Sati practices illegal and punishable by law.
In ‘SATI System’, the wife of the dead burned herself in the funeral pyre of her husband
